MA-Studium an der London School of Economics and Social Sciences, London (UK) und PhD-Studium der Politikwissenschaften am European University Institute in Florenz (Italien) sowie an der University of California, Berkeley (USA)
Forschungstätigkeiten am European University Institute in Florenz (Italien) sowie an der Universität Genf
Leitung verschiedener, durch den Schweizerischen Nationalfonds (SNF) finanzierter Projekte im Bereich der direkten Demokratie sowie Koordination wissenschaftlicher Projekte zum Thema E-Partizipation
Lehre an den Universitäten Genf, Zürich sowie der ETH Zürich
